2. Reasons for Tech Company Layoffs

Tech company layoffs can occur due to a variety of factors. One primary reason is the constantly evolving nature of the tech industry, which necessitates the need for continual adaptation and restructuring. Companies may need to downsize or reorganize their workforce to align with changing business goals or market conditions. Technological advancements, such as automation and artificial intelligence, can also contribute to job displacements, leading to layoffs. Economic recessions or financial difficulties may force companies to make challenging decisions regarding their workforce. 3. Impact of Tech Company Layoffs

Tech company layoffs have far-reaching consequences that extend beyond the immediate loss of jobs. The individuals directly affected by layoffs experience emotional, financial, and professional setbacks, which can have long-lasting effects on their lives. Companies, on the other hand, face potential reputational damage, decreased morale among remaining employees, and disruptions in workflow. Furthermore, the broader tech industry is impacted as layoffs contribute to increased competition for jobs, potentially leading to a talent drain. 5. Strategies for Effective Job Reductions

When layoffs are inevitable, implementing effective strategies becomes crucial to minimize negative impacts and facilitate a smoother transition. Companies must engage in careful planning, ensuring that the process is transparent, fair, and respectful. Effective communication is paramount at every stage, providing clear reasons for the layoffs and offering support to affected employees. Reevaluation of business priorities, identification of key positions, and the provision of retraining or outplacement services can also contribute to successful job reductions. 6. Rebuilding Employee Morale After Layoffs

After experiencing a round of layoffs, companies must focus on rebuilding employee morale to navigate the post-layoff landscape effectively. Open and honest communication becomes even more critical during this phase, providing reassurance to the remaining workforce and addressing any concerns or uncertainties they may have. Recognizing and appreciating the contributions of employees, emphasizing career development opportunities, and fostering a positive work environment can help rebuild trust and motivation. Implementing thoughtful programs or initiatives that promote teamwork, employee well-being, and work-life balance can also contribute to a positive and resilient workforce.

9. Future Trends in Tech Company Layoffs

As the tech industry continues to evolve, future trends in tech company layoffs are likely to emerge. Technological advancements, such as increased automation and artificial intelligence, may result in further displacements and job reductions. The growing gig economy and remote work arrangements may also impact the nature of layoffs and the composition of the tech workforce.
